> In Cygwin, create a mount entry for the drive and add the "noacl" flag. > Then set the permissions on the root dir of the drive to full control > for Everyone and make sure permissions are propagted to child objects.
I did that but I now have many of the following errors when I backup my files with rsync from local hard drive d: (ntfs) to usb hard drive g: (ntfs, mounted with noacl in /mnt/g): $ rsync --modify-window=1 --recursive --links --executability --times --quiet --delete /cygdrive/d/Documents /mnt/g/Sauvegarde/ rsync: rename "/mnt/g/Sauvegarde/Documents/Fred/Bal/1.7/Bal/gcc-release/bin/.configure.exe.JVPk8f" -> "Documents/Fred/Bal/1.7/Bal/gcc-release/bin/configure.exe": Device or resource busy (16) when rsync ends, .configure.exe.?????? still exists and configure.exe does not exist or both do not exist Each time I try to use ntfs on USB drives, it turns to a nightmare... maybe I will switch again to fat32.
